CRUISE REVIEW - PACIFIC SKY

Posted 8 Sep 05

I just got back from 23 August sailing from brisbane to noumea, isle de pines, ovea, mystery island and port vila, this was my 3rd Pacific Sky cruise and by far the best.

The islands were all fantastic especially ovea. We were an inaugural call, and it helped that the weather was fantastic most of the time. We had 1 rainy day in the afternoon at mystery island but it cleared up for the island nite celabrations. The ship was immaculate, the Captain Stefano Raviera loves this ship, he does a walk thru every day and has a chat with all passengers and gets his photo taken if they ask, he invited us up to the bridge. James Ibriham and his off-sider Michael were are scream and great cruise directors even if they recycle their jokes. The usual shipboard activities - perfect match, marriage game, celebrity heads and such then there were the entertainers patricio rodrigrues a mexican singer fantastic and ugly dave grey who was very sick but he still managed to do one show.

The food I thought has improved. Dinners were italian nite welcome dinner, french etc, very good quality seeing they have to serve 1000 people. The wine waiters have dissapeared in dining room, wine started at about $18 per bottle, lunches on deck were always pretty good, although I prefer to eat in the dining room. There are also themed buffets as well. I spoke to the maitre de mario propato who had only been on board 2 trips and was leaving at end of following cruise he told me they will probably reintroduce alacarte in dining rooms for breakfast and lunch. Also had a fantastic seafood platter with him and 2 fine ladies who shall remain nameless at rossis in port vila, go there if you ever get the chance their tusker beer in vila is pretty good too. By the way the ships perfume and duty free booze is reasonably priced nowadays don't buy any duty free in australia buy it on ship or port vila where it is even cheaper.

Any way jump on this ship if you get the chance you won't regret it.
